Searched refs:ARCTargetMachine (Results 1 – 6 of 6) sorted by relevance
/freebsd/contrib/llvm-project/llvm/lib/Target/ARC/ |
H A D | ARCTargetMachine.cpp | 30 ARCTargetMachine::ARCTargetMachine(const Target &T, const Triple &TT, in ARCTargetMachine() function in ARCTargetMachine 46 ARCTargetMachine::~ARCTargetMachine() = default; 53 ARCPassConfig(ARCTargetMachine &TM, PassManagerBase &PM) in ARCPassConfig() 56 ARCTargetMachine &getARCTargetMachine() const { in getARCTargetMachine() 57 return getTM<ARCTargetMachine>(); in getARCTargetMachine() 68 TargetPassConfig *ARCTargetMachine::createPassConfig(PassManagerBase &PM) { in createPassConfig() 90 MachineFunctionInfo *ARCTargetMachine::createMachineFunctionInfo( in createMachineFunctionInfo() 98 RegisterTargetMachine<ARCTargetMachine> X(getTheARCTarget()); in LLVMInitializeARCTarget() 104 ARCTargetMachine::getTargetTransformInfo(const Function &F) const { in getTargetTransformInfo()
|
H A D | ARCTargetMachine.h | 1 //===- ARCTargetMachine.h - Define TargetMachine for ARC --------*- C++ -*-===// 24 class ARCTargetMachine : public LLVMTargetMachine { 29 ARCTargetMachine(const Target &T, const Triple &TT, StringRef CPU, 34 ~ARCTargetMachine() override;
|
H A D | ARC.h | 22 class ARCTargetMachine; variable 26 FunctionPass *createARCISelDag(ARCTargetMachine &TM, CodeGenOptLevel OptLevel);
|
H A D | ARCTargetTransformInfo.h | 27 class ARCTargetMachine; variable 40 explicit ARCTTIImpl(const ARCTargetMachine *TM, const Function &F) in ARCTTIImpl()
|
H A D | ARCISelDAGToDAG.cpp | 46 ARCDAGToDAGISel(ARCTargetMachine &TM, CodeGenOptLevel OptLevel) in ARCDAGToDAGISel() 64 explicit ARCDAGToDAGISelLegacy(ARCTargetMachine &TM, CodeGenOptLevel OptLevel) in ARCDAGToDAGISelLegacy() 77 FunctionPass *llvm::createARCISelDag(ARCTargetMachine &TM, in INITIALIZE_PASS()
|
H A D | ARCISelLowering.h | 25 class ARCTargetMachine; variable
|